Consistent Good Quality and Excellent Value I've been buying from them for several years now, mostly for lunch and small parties, and have never been disappointed. Their soon kueh is probably their signature product - very smooth thin skin and very well balanced flavour. Next would be their char sha bao - relatively thin skin and very tasty filling. Their da bao would be third - skin tends to be thick and filling very full mouth feel.
